add_library(<name> INTERFACE [IMPORTED] [GLOBAL])
来源:互联网 发布:设备动静密封点数据 编辑:程序博客网 时间:2024/06/10 01:44
作用:
创建一个接口库
属性:
该接口可被设置属性,也可被安装,导出和导入。一般使用以下方法设置它的属性(INTERFACE_*):
1.set_property()
2.target_link_libraries(INTERFACE)
3.target_include_directories(INTERFACE)
=》添加一个include目录到目标文件,即INTERFACE
4.target_compile_options(INTERFACE)
5.target_compile_definitions(INTERFACE)
最后:
该接口作为target_link_libraries()的参数被使用
阅读全文
0 0
- add_library(<name> INTERFACE [IMPORTED] [GLOBAL])
- 关于 Global Database Name
- Cmake-add_library
- Network Interface name change
- Difference between Global DB name and SID
- NameError: global name 'closing' is not defined
- global name 'FileNotFoundError' is not defined
- DECLARE_META_INTERFACE(INTERFACE)和IMPLEMENT_META_INTERFACE(INTERFACE, NAME)宏定义分析
- How to Get Interface Name List
- Get ip address from an interface name
- JNDI-( Java Name and Driectory Interface)
- How to change network interface name
- JNI获取android wifi interface name
- JNDI Java Name and Directory Interface
- SVProgressHUD 报错 Unexpected interface name
- Global Domain Name Registration www.apidnr.com.hk
- GAE报错“NameError: global name 'execfile' is not defined”
- 关于database link 和 domain 和 global name
- 登录界面异常(Android)
- jQuery基础
- Hadoop概念了解及展望
- mysql explain
- 排序-插入排序-折半插入排序-数据结构(27)
- add_library(<name> INTERFACE [IMPORTED] [GLOBAL])
- 使用epoll+时间堆实现高性能定时器
- 一篇写并查集的好文章
- zabbix configure: error: MySQL library not found
- 容器的基础XmlBeanFactory。
- redis队列的实现
- springmvc统一的异常处理
- n a^o7 !(山东省第三届ACM大学生程序设计竞赛 )
- 【笔试】try{}finally{}中的return